Cannabinoids present in cannabis

The natural chemicals in cannabis known as cannabinoids regulate many bodily functions. THC, CBD and other cannabinoids are the most commonly used. Both compounds have their own effects and can be used for a variety symptoms. THC is a psychoactive cannabinoid while CBD is not. Cannabis can be used to treat anxiety and other conditions.

Cannabinoids lower the addiction to addictive substances

Studies have shown that cannabinoids in cannabis reduce the use and cravings for addictive substances. These compounds act as a deterrent to drug use and are similar to those found in other plant-based medications. They are known to promote feelings and well-being, reduce cravings, break down cycles of dependence, and increase self-control. They may also help in treating conditions such as anxiety and depression. While there is currently no treatment for marijuana addiction available, recent research suggests it may be in the future.

Cannabidiol improves neuroplasticity

Neuroplasticity refers to the process whereby the brain creates new connections and strengthens existing ones. Neuroplasticity is an important factor in cognitive enhancement and can help prevent dementia and Alzheimer’s disease. It provides alternate routes for information travel within the brain.

It reduces anxiety

Patients and researchers are increasingly turning to cannabis for anxiety disorders treatment. This compound can help with anxiety and stress. It is also good for chronic phobias. The legalization of cannabis as a treatment for anxiety disorders is increasing in many states. Many patients believe that cannabis is a safer and more effective alternative to pharmaceuticals. But, further research is required to prove that cannabis can treat anxiety disorders.

Treats Tourette syndrome

Recent research has indicated that medical marijuana may reduce the tics that are associated with Tourette syndrome. It has been shown to alleviate anxiety and depression. Twelve Tourette Syndrome patients were treated with cannabis extracts. The results showed significant improvement in their tics, obsessive-compulsive behaviour and tics. The active components in cannabis offer relief from anxiety, depression, and stress.

Reduces spasticity

Studies have shown that marijuana can provide many health benefits to those suffering from spasticity. Cannabis, especially the THC in marijuana, can alleviate symptoms of spasticity, thereby improving quality of life. Additionally, cannabis can be used to combat insomnia, a common condition among sufferers of spasticity. It can be used to aid patients in sleeping, which makes them feel refreshed and less tired when they wake up. There are many ways to get these benefits from marijuana, including smoking and vaping. Patients enjoy vaping for the convenience of being able to choose the marijuana they desire and experience instant relief. However, some patients prefer to consume other forms of cannabis, such as edibles or extracts.
